What are Private Label Dog Treats?
Definition of Private Label Dog Treats
Private label dog treats are essentially products that are manufactured by one company but sold under another company's brand name. Think of it like this: a dog treat manufacturer produces tasty snacks, but instead of selling them under their own label, they allow other businesses to slap on their branding. This means you can offer your customers unique, high-quality treats without needing to invest in your own production facilities. It’s a win-win for both you and the manufacturer!
Benefits of Using Private Label Pet Products
When you opt for private label pet products, you unlock a treasure trove of benefits. First, you get to control your brand's image. You can create unique packaging and branding that speaks directly to your target audience. Plus, you can customize the flavors and ingredients to cater to specific preferences—think soft chews for older dogs or all-natural options for health-conscious pet parents. Another significant advantage is the cost savings; you don’t have to worry about the overhead costs of production, allowing you to focus on marketing your new pet treats.
How Private Label Differs from Generic Products
Now, you might wonder how private label dog treats differ from generic products. The key difference lies in branding and quality. Generic products often lack a unique brand identity and are typically produced in large quantities with a focus on cost-efficiency. Private label products, on the other hand, are tailored to meet specific market needs and come with a brand story that resonates with customers. With private label pet treats, you put your stamp on the product, making it distinct and special in a sea of generic options.
How to Choose a Dog Treat Manufacturer?
Criteria for Selecting a Dog Treat Manufacturer
Choosing the right dog treat manufacturer is crucial for your success. Start by looking for a company with a solid reputation and experience in pet product manufacturing. You want to partner with a manufacturer that specializes in private label pet products and understands the unique needs of the pet industry. Quality is paramount, so ensure that they adhere to safety standards and use high-quality ingredients in their dog treats. It’s also important to consider their production capabilities—can they handle small batch orders or scale up as your business grows?
Top Private Label Pet Treat Manufacturers
There are some leading private label manufacturers in the pet treat space that have built a strong reputation over the years. Companies like Phelps Pet Products and Carnivore Meat Company are known for their high-quality offerings and expertise in treat manufacturing. It’s worth noting, however, that both of these manufacturers have very high minimums and long lead times. They provide a variety of options, from soft chews to crunchy treats, and can assist you in developing your brand’s unique line of private label dog treats. Researching and reaching out to these manufacturers can be a great first step in your journey.
Questions to Ask Your Potential Manufacturer
Before finalizing a partnership, you should ask potential manufacturers some key questions. Inquire about their production processes and ingredient sourcing—transparency is essential. Ask about minimum order quantities and lead times, as these factors will impact your inventory management and budget. It’s also wise to discuss any customization options available for private label pet treats and how they handle quality control. Lastly, don’t forget to ask for samples! You want to ensure that the taste and texture of the treats meet your standards.

Comparing Contract Manufacturing Options for Pet Products
In the world of pet treats, understanding the difference between private label and contract manufacturing can save you from a lot of headaches. While private label manufacturing involves branding an existing product, contract manufacturing offers more customization. This option allows you to create unique formulations based on your specifications. Consider your business goals: if you're looking to build a distinctive line of private label dog treats, exploring contract manufacturing options could open up exciting avenues for innovation. Just remember, whether you go for private label dog treats or a more bespoke contract manufacturing route, choosing the right partner is essential for success.

Formulating Chew Treats: Key Considerations
When it comes to formulating chew treats, several key considerations must be taken into account. Texture is paramount; soft chews might be perfect for senior dogs, while tougher textures could be ideal for aggressive chewers. Additionally, flavor profiles are essential. Dogs have unique taste preferences, and incorporating a variety of flavors can help you capture a broader audience. Don't forget about functional ingredients! Adding elements that promote dental health or joint support can set your private label dog treats apart from the competition.
Freeze-Dry vs. Traditional Methods for Dog Treats
The method of production can significantly affect the quality of dog treats. Freeze-drying, for instance, is a technique that preserves the nutritional value of ingredients while creating a crunchy texture that can be irresistible to dogs. On the other hand, traditional methods can also yield delicious results but may not retain the same level of nutrients. When considering private label manufacturing, it's essential to discuss these methods with your manufacturer. They can guide you on the best approach to ensure product quality and appeal, helping you create treats that are not just tasty but also wholesome.
